Comments:
This terminal reservoir stores water from Lake Hodges and provides emergency water to the Santa Fe Irrigation District (SFID) and the San Dieguito Water District (SDWD). It also serves as a flood control facility and is fenced off and closed to public access.

Comments:

Species account of Western and Clark's breeding in San Diego County. Winter dates included due to winter breeding and broods observed. 1998 observers were J. Determan and K. Aldern.
